Philippine Diplomatic Missions in UAE Reveal Ramadan 2026 Working Hours

Date:

New operating hours for the holy month have been announced for public guidance.

Dubai: The Philippine Embassy in Abu Dhabi and the Philippine Consulate General in Dubai and the Northern Emirates have announced revised business hours for Ramadan 2026.

According to an advisory, operations will run from 7:30 a.m. to 2:30 p.m., Monday to Thursday, and from 7:30 a.m. to 12:00 p.m. on Fridays. Regular working hours will resume after Eid Al Fitr.

The Ministry of Human Resources and Emiratisation has confirmed that private sector employees across the UAE are entitled to a mandatory two-hour reduction in daily working hours during the holy month of Ramadan. This adjustment applies to both Muslim and non-Muslim workers.

Meanwhile, Dubai’s Islamic Affairs and Charitable Activities Department has indicated that Ramadan is expected to begin on February 19, 2026, with the official start date to be confirmed by the UAE Moon-Sighting Committee following the crescent moon sighting on the eve of the month.
